DELAIGUE, CONSTANTIN VICTOR (1878-1968). Copper-gold patinated bronze of Dante Alighieri. Dante's journey through hell is depicted. He is standing on a stone slab, under which is Hell. Dante's Journey through Hell is also known as “Dante's Inferno”, the first part of the “Divine Comedy”, H: 27.5 cm.
